@ahmad996: Assassin's creed 2 was a very poorly designed game in my opinion. Especially the combat. Here's how I won 95% of the battles in the game:

- I simply kept pressing the right mouse button all the time, which could block almost all incoming attacks
- Once in a while I would press the left mouse button which would hit or kill an enemy
- Usually, I had like 30 pieces of health in the left upper corner, and getting hit would remove like one of those 30 pieces. So even though it was almost impossible to get hit, you could still get hit 20 times in a row without dying.

Only at the very end of the game you encounter a couple of enemies which can break through your block. But they too are very easily defeated.

I did enjoy playing Assassin's Creed II, but the combat of the game is definitely the most shallow and easy combat I've ever seen in my life.

And then the missions, what you had to do in most main story missions felt like filler to me. Like side-stuff. Where were the complex assassination missions where you had to think ahead, plan a strategy, wait for opportunities to arise, think about an exit-plan for after the assassination etc. All the missions were almost completely mindless.

So yeah, AC II for me was not nearly the best game in the series. Since then, the series has moved on. @dr_vancouver: internet quality varies strongly depending on the type of internet you have (fibre, cable, or over phone line). If you have internet over a phone line (adsl or vdsl) the speed and reliability of the internet vary strongly depending on time of day and how far away you are from the nearest exchange point.

Also, there are plenty of bad providers which have outages or slow speeds very regularly.

Moreover, in a lot of countries very strict data limits are still enforced.

And internet quality isn't the same in every country. Plenty of countries with very poor internet which sells for very high prices.

And i have to mention that a lot of people share their internet. Other people in the house using Youtube, Netflix or other streaming services can cause you to lag, warp or disconnect.

Unfortunately not all routers are of very high quality. Some people use poor quality routers with very buggy firmware. They leak in many things including the NAT tables and need to be regularly reset to regain speed and stability.

Last but not least, a lot of people don't like cables and use wifi. Interference is a real thing and can cause lag spikes.

And I've not even mentioned the people that forget to disable the 10 other installed applications' auto-update mechanisms which during gaming sessions decide to interfere by downloading hefty updates.
